How to use Git & GitHub: Love Data Week

Looking to get started with Git & GitHub?In this hands on workshop, participants will install and use Git on their laptops and learn how to upload Git repositories to GitHub.  Git is a Version Control System (VCS) that aids in collaborative projects, and GitHub is an online platform for hosting Git repositories.

This workshop requires software installation on the participant's laptop and familiarity with the Terminal (Mac/Linus) or Git bash (Windows PC).
